>>The best approach I've seen so far was at a station in Monterey, California, back in the '80's. The tower was in the bay at the end of a pier off Cannery Row, and the ground was salt water, with no radials at all. That station ran only a kilowatt, but you could hear it 40 miles away.
I don't know the station in Monterey but the KGU, KHNR, KHCM tower is interesting. It has galvinized pipes going into the ground and the salt water table is only 1.8 meters below ground. Here is the KHCM app. Nice diagram about 17 pages in.
